In support of military families around the world, Cohen Veterans Network has launched a new educational course “Tools for Managing Stress and Worry”. The self-paced, free online course was specifically created to help manage stress and worry through a series of brief, easy-to-use tools, strategies, and techniques that participants can access whenever and wherever they need.

During this period of uncertainty, military families are faced with unique stressors causing enormous strain, including interrupted PCS plans, activations and deployments, shifting childcare and child education plans, personal finances and employment insecurity. These challenges can intensify stress and worry, making them more difficult to manage.

In partnership with Blue Star Families, CVN’s Clinical Training team designed the course to support the unique needs of military families around the globe. The course uses a research-based approach made up of brief modules designed to fit into small windows of time.
